* crypto: user - Prepare for CRYPTO_MAX_ALG_NAME expansionHerbert Xu2017-04-101-5/+5
| | | | | | | | | | | | | | | | | This patch hard-codes CRYPTO_MAX_NAME in the user-space API to 64, which is the current value of CRYPTO_MAX_ALG_NAME. This patch also replaces all remaining occurences of CRYPTO_MAX_ALG_NAME in the user-space API with CRYPTO_MAX_NAME. This way the user-space API will not be modified when we raise the value of CRYPTO_MAX_ALG_NAME. Furthermore, the code has been updated to handle names longer than the user-space API. They will be truncated. * crypto: kpp - Key-agreement Protocol Primitives API (KPP)Salvatore Benedetto2016-06-231-0/+5
| | | | | | | | | | | | | | | | | | | Add key-agreement protocol primitives (kpp) API which allows to implement primitives required by protocols such as DH and ECDH. The API is composed mainly by the following functions * set_secret() - It allows the user to set his secret, also referred to as his private key, along with the parameters known to both parties involved in the key-agreement session. * generate_public_key() - It generates the public key to be sent to the other counterpart involved in the key-agreement session. The function has to be called after set_params() and set_secret() * generate_secret() - It generates the shared secret for the session Other functions such as init() and exit() are provided for allowing cryptographic hardware to be inizialized properly before use Signed-off-by: Salvatore Benedetto <salvatore.benedetto@intel.com> Signed-off-by: Herbert Xu <herbert@gondor.apana.org.au>
* crypto: user - Add CRYPTO_MSG_DELRNGHerbert Xu2015-06-221-0/+1
| | | | | | | | | This patch adds a new crypto_user command that allows the admin to delete the crypto system RNG. Note that this can only be done if the RNG is currently not in use. The next time it is used a new system RNG will be allocated. Signed-off-by: Herbert Xu <herbert@gondor.apana.org.au>
